CHAPTER 26 Swiftflight licked at a small scar on her leg from the battle with EmberPack, nibbling at the frayed edges. Her heart was thumping so hard she was afraid it would burst out of her chest. It was time. Time for one of the most grim and terrible Trials. The Sacrifice Trial. No Battle for the Beta contestant was told what they'd be faced up against, but Swiftflight had heard of wolves who had not survived this Trial due to some terrible 'accident'. As Swiftflight was thinking this, a deep, baying howl echoed through the shadowy passageways of DarkPack territory. Swiftflight froze. Obsidian was calling them for the Sacrifice Trial.... right now. She staggered to her paws from where she was lying on a cosy moss-bed, her head booming with a frenzied anxiety. Beside her, Titan gave a faint moan of worry as he, too, clambered clumsily to his powerful paws. He might be able to beat whatever's waiting, Swiftflight thought faintly as she padded down the passageway to the exit of the cave, where all of the contestants would make there way to the sinisterly-named Clearing of Bloodshed, but I'm not sure I could... Swiftflight raised her head to gaze at Obsidian who was seated majestically on the temporary Alpha's Rock in the middle of the muddy clearing. "You probably already know why I have summoned you," Obsidian barked. Swiftflight felt a shiver of sympathy for her, despite her condition. The misty-grey Alpha looked flustered and weary, yet she was still coping, for the well-being and strength of her Pack. "This is one of the most serious Trials. This isn't make-believe any more-" she lowered her head to look solemnly into each contestant's eyes. "-This is real. You'll have to face one of our most powerful and fierce enemies... You'll have to ultimately prove your loyalty and devotion to your Alpha and your Pack. We don't need Lynx any more... It'll be me." Swiftflight shivered, unsure if she wanted to know what the 'it' in this Trial was. Swiftflight was interrupted by a muffled thump as Obsidian propelled herself strongly off the rock. Her eyes were deeper and more grim than Swiftflight had ever seen them before. "The first wolf I choose shall come with me where my party of warriors are waiting." She scoured her eyes meaningfully across the sea of wolves. Swiftflight's blood thumped in her ears as her Alpha's piercing gaze fell on her. No! she thought fearfully. No, no, no- "Swiftflight, come with me," Obsidian boomed, though her eyes were gentle and calm. Soothing, almost. Swiftflight felt herself gliding over to her Alpha. She felt a prickle: Bloodsight's uncomfortable, pink gaze on the back of her neck and her paw twitched as if it had a life of its own. "This way." Obsidian's powerful growl interrupted Swiftflight. Swiftflight lifted her head and nodded to show she had heard. Alpha's shaggy grey haunches vanished through a thick, spiky bush and Swiftflight followed her, wincing as thorns pricked at her delicate paw pads and muzzle. She almost bumped into Obsidian as she stopped. There was a ring of eight warriors, each had something clasped in their jaw. Swiftflight narrowed her eyes, trying to see what it was- A bellowing roar interrupted Swiftflight and she let out a yelp of pure fear, scrambling back. Behind the warriors stood a menacing, deep-chested, hulking shape... "Bear!" Swiftflight yelped in an agony of fear. "Let the beast come forth," Obsidian growled. Swiftflight felt a dizzying fear choke her throat and all she could do was watch, wide eyed as the warriors silently parted, letting the bear come forward. Obsidian stepped forward, towards the bear. Swiftflight gave a low whine of fear and uncertainty. What in Lupus' name is she DOING? She thought anxiously, her gaze trained on the bear's huge, shaggy paws. Then, with a terrifying, grating snarl the bear lunged forward, its jaws slavering. The warriors stood there stiffly, a low chant rumbling in their throats. "Attack... attack... attack..." they rasped. Swiftflight's tail spun with fear. They're willing the bear on! she realized through the dense mist of fear. The bear was charging closer, closer. Obsidian's eyes held no panic. Just a deep, deathly calm. Swiftflight's protective instincts whirred and a certainty stole over her. I must protect Alpha, she thought. Even if I die. She lunged forward, eyes closed and paws outstretched, right in the bear's path, protecting Obsidian. She closed her eyes waiting for the crunch of its fangs on her bones... But it never came. There was a heavy clanking sound of chains as the warriors shoved it back, pulling the chains - and the bear - back. Swiftflight opened her eyes, mid-leap. Obsidian's eyes were shining as she turned to Swiftflight. "That's just what you needed to do!" she yelped joyfully, wagging her tail warmly.
